BOTANICAL AND FORESTRY DEPARTMENT—Continued

Office Name Date of Appointment Authority Annual Salary House or Quarters, and Allowances for Rent, Entertainment, Personal, or for any other purpose Absence from the Colony during 1923 Date of First Appointment
Forest Guard Pang Kau 1st September, 1920 No. 1255 of 1908 $336 5 days 1st October, 1917
Do. Wong Fat 1st October, 1917 No. 1255 of 1908 $336 1 day 1st February, 1911
Do. Wai Kwong 1st February, 1911 No. 1255 of 1908 $336 1st May, 1909
Do. Chan Lini 10th December, 1921 No. 1255 of 1908 $240 20th February, 1917
4 Foresters $528 (at $132 each) Quarters, Rent Allowance to 4 at $12 each, Good Conduct Allowance to 1 at $36

EDUCATION

Office Name Date of Appointment Authority Annual Salary House or Quarters, and Allowances for Rent, Entertainment, Personal, or for any other purpose Absence from the Colony during 1923 Date of First Appointment
DIRECTOR OF EDUCATION
Director of Education Edward Alexander Irving (1) 24th April, 1901 C.O.D. No. 207 of 1901 £1,500 £120 Personal Allowance as Director, Technical Institute 9 months and 14 days 25th March, 1891
Inspector of English Schools Edwin Ralphs (2) 1st October, 1913 No. 2971 of 1913 £900 23rd March, 1898
Inspector of Vernacular Schools Arthur Ramsden Cavalier 9th May, 1914 Do. £675 1st November, 1911
Sub-Inspector of Vernacular Schools, Urban District Law Yau-pak 20th February, 1920 No. 6502 of 1910 $560 2 days 1st January, 1915
Do. Robert Andrew Dermod Forrest 1st January, 1922 No. 877 of 1921 $450 16th October, 1919
Do. Yu Wau, B.A. 1st July, 1922 No. 812 of 1920 $120 2 days 25th June, 1920
Sub-Inspector of Vernacular Schools, Urban District Lui Chuk-chong 1st September, 1923 No. 25 in 86 of 1915 $1,250 1st September, 1915
Do. La Tau-wing 1st March, 1920 No. 807 of 1920 $825 1st March, 1920
Chan Tai-sheung (3) 1st June, 1915
Senior Sub-Inspector of Vernacular Schools for New Territories Lai Kuk-yuen 9th April, 1923 No. 4 in 59 of 1922 $900 17th February, 1919
Do. Ho Tat-cheung 17th February, 1919 No. 6502 of 1910 $750 1st June, 1915
Do. Chan Tai-sheung (+) 9th April, 1920 No. 807 of 1920 $800 17th February, 1919
